U.S. patent number D756,463 [Application Number D/487,783] was granted by the patent office on 2016-05-17 for panel display plate. This patent grant is currently assigned to Atomic Design Inc.. The grantee listed for this patent is Atomic Design Inc.. Invention is credited to Thomas McPhillips.

Description



FIG. 1 is a rear, top and right side perspective view of a panel display plate, showing the new design;

FIG. 2 is a rear elevation view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front elevation view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a reduced scale left side elevation view thereof; and,

FIG. 5 is an enlarged top plan view thereof.

The broken lines shown in the Figures are included to show unclaimed subject matter only and form no part of the claimed design.
